Cleaning uPVC windows

While uPVC window repairs are simple to clean, it's essential to make use of the correct tools and materials. By doing so, you can prevent the accumulation of dust and moisture which can damage your uPVC windows.

First, you'll want to get rid of all dirt and debris from your uPVC window. This can be accomplished with the use of a brush or a soft, clean cloth that has been dipped in the soapy warm water.

Once you've removed all of the debris, clean the frame of the uPVC. When cleaning uPVC, it is recommended to avoid liquids, chemicals, and harsh cleaners. This is because these can cause irreparable damage. Instead, choose a non-abrasive cleaner solution which is diluted with water.

You can also clean your uPVC window sills. However, this requires the assistance of an expert. It is also recommended to avoid sanding your uPVC. Use a soft-nozzle brush.

If your upvc windows repair near me is stained it is recommended you use a upvc window repairs near me spray paint. These spray paints come in a range of colors and are made to give a premium finish. They are a great option if you're looking to revive your uPVC windows.

You are also able to find a reliable uPVC solvent cleaner at your local hardware store. Diluted uPVC cleaners with water are the most secure. Make sure that you don't accidentally smear the glass with the cleaner.

After finishing cleaning, you'll have to dry the window with a non-abrasive cloth. Then , you can polish the glass using a microfiber towel.

If you're trying to keep your uPVC window frames in great condition, try to clean them at least twice a year. In addition to that, if they're situated close to trees, you might require having them cleaned more frequently.

Maintaining your uPVC doors and windows in good condition will help to increase your home's value. Having them cleaned and maintained regularly can lessen the need for costly repairs. Your home can be shielded from mould and moisture by maintaining your uPVC windows clean.

uPVC windows last a long time

The life span of uPVC windows can extend up to 35 years based on the quality of the product. The average lifespan of uPVC windows ranges between 20 and 25 years. Proper maintenance can increase the life span of UPVC windows.

The life expectancy of upvc window repair near me windows is affected by the quality of the raw materials used. Materials that are not of the highest quality can decrease the life span of a uPVC window to as little as 5 years. To prevent this, examine the pigmentation of the product. Low pigmentation could be an indication that the formula doesn't contain enough UV-resistant ingredients.

Other factors that can affect the life span of a uPVC product include a lack of proper installation. If the installation is not done correctly, an UPVC product might not be watertight, and may also be exposed to corrosion.

uPVC is known to withstand harsh weather conditions. However, it is not as strong as aluminium. It is susceptible to being damaged by excessive humidity or heat.

Like all window, an UPVC window will need to be replaced at some time. If you are planning to purchase a uPVC window, make sure you choose a reputable firm. This will guarantee you a high-quality product.
